Outdoor Kitchen vs. Grill Station — What’s the Difference for Oklahoma Homeowners?

One of the most common questions we hear from Broken Arrow and Tulsa homeowners during initial consultations is: “What’s the difference between a grill station and an outdoor kitchen?” It’s a fair question — the terms are sometimes used interchangeably, but they describe meaningfully different builds with different price points, functionality, and long-term value.

The Grill Station

A grill station is a built-in structure — typically a single island or short counter — that houses a built-in grill as its primary feature. It may include a small amount of counter space on either side of the grill and possibly one or two additional components like a side burner or small storage cabinet.

Typical Grill Station Features

  • Built-in grill (the primary feature)
  • 2–4 feet of counter space total
  • Possibly one side burner
  • Storage cabinet or drawer underneath
  • No refrigeration, no sink, no dedicated prep area

Who It’s Right For

A grill station makes sense for Oklahoma homeowners who:

  • Have a smaller outdoor space or tighter budget
  • Primarily grill rather than cook full outdoor meals
  • Want to upgrade from a freestanding cart grill but aren’t ready for a full kitchen investment
  • Are building in phases — starting with the grill station and expanding later

Typical Cost in Oklahoma

A built-in grill station in the Broken Arrow and Tulsa market typically ranges from $4,000–$10,000 installed, depending on materials, grill brand, and countertop selection.

The Full Outdoor Kitchen

A full outdoor kitchen is a complete cooking, entertaining, and serving environment built outdoors. It treats the backyard as an extension of your home’s kitchen — not just a spot to grill.

Typical Full Outdoor Kitchen Features

  • Built-in grill (primary cooking station)
  • 8–20+ feet of counter and prep space
  • Outdoor-rated refrigerator
  • Prep sink with running water
  • Side burners or dedicated cooking zones
  • Bar area or serving counter
  • Storage cabinets and drawers
  • Outdoor-rated ice maker (on higher-end builds)
  • Possible pizza oven, smoker, or griddle station
  • Integrated lighting
  • Often covered by pergola or pavilion

Who It’s Right For

A full outdoor kitchen makes sense for Oklahoma homeowners who:

  • Entertain regularly and want a fully functional outdoor cooking environment
  • Want to maximize the value and functionality of their outdoor space
  • Plan to stay in their home long-term and want a permanent investment
  • Want the highest return on investment — full outdoor kitchens add significant home value in the Tulsa metro market

Typical Cost in Oklahoma

A full outdoor kitchen in the Broken Arrow and Tulsa market typically ranges from $15,000–$60,000+ depending on size, materials, appliance package, and whether a pergola or pavilion is included.

Can You Upgrade a Grill Station to a Full Kitchen Later?

Yes — if it’s designed for expansion from the start. At VistaScapes Design, we often build grill stations with expansion in mind: running gas lines with extra capacity, roughing in plumbing for a future sink, and designing the initial structure so additional island sections can be added seamlessly.
